Typical Life Expectancy of Oral Implants



When considering oral implants, one of the essential concerns is their life expectancy. Usually, you can anticipate dental implants to last anywhere from 10 to 15 years, and numerous also last a life time with correct care. Unlike all-natural teeth, implants do not struggle with decay, which contributes to their long life.

However, it's necessary to keep excellent oral hygiene and keep up with routine oral visits to guarantee they stay in good condition.

The titanium message that incorporates with your jawbone is exceptionally resilient, giving a strong structure for the implant crown. Considering that the products utilized in dental implants are developed to hold up against everyday wear and tear, you will not have to fret about them damaging or coming to be harmed like natural teeth.

That said, private factors such as your total health, way of life, and oral health habits can affect how long your implants last. If you smoke or have particular clinical conditions, you might experience a much shorter lifespan.

Secret Elements Affecting Long Life



Numerous crucial aspects can considerably influence the longevity of your dental implants. First, the top quality of the implant itself plays a vital duty. High-quality materials and advanced innovation tend to produce much better results and durability.



Next off, the skill of your oral doctor is essential. A knowledgeable and qualified expert can place your implants correctly, lessening complications that can arise in the future.

Your overall oral health is one more essential variable. If you have periodontal condition or various other dental issues, it can jeopardize the stability of your implants. Keeping a healthy lifestyle, consisting of a well balanced diet plan and staying clear of cigarette smoking, aids advertise healing and long life.

Moreover, your body's ability to recover and integrate the dental implant affects its life-span. family medical care like age, medical problems, and medications can affect this process.

Finally, your bite and just how you utilize your teeth can influence the longevity of the implants. Too much grinding or clinching can bring about early wear.

Upkeep for Resilient Implants



Keeping your oral implants is vital for ensuring their durability and optimum feature. Initially, you must adhere to a strenuous oral health routine. Brush your teeth twice a day with a soft-bristle tooth brush and non-abrasive tooth paste to prevent harming the implant surface area.

Don't neglect to floss daily, as it assists get rid of food particles and plaque that can result in gum condition.

Normal dental check-ups are likewise important. Arrange professional cleanings and examinations at least two times a year. Your dentist can keep an eye on the wellness of your periodontals and the integrity of the implants, dealing with any kind of issues before they escalate.
